Hipsters are tripping all over themselves to try “smoossies” (that is, smoothies) and juices these days, and some of the best can be found at this terrific vegetarian restaurant, which has become the place to sample muffins, bagels, soups, and other delicious vegetarian goodies. The brainchild of Marc Grossman (alias “Bob”), an erstwhile New Yorker, this may not be the most authentically French experience, but it certainly is a tasty one. You can sit down or take out here, or try the Bob’s Bake Shop in La Chapelle (Halle Pajol, 12 Espl. Nathalie Sarraute, 18th arrond.) or in the famous Shakespeare and Company bookshop cafe, 37 rue de la Bûcherie, 5th arrond.
